Maintenance Tips of BYD 1331109800 Lane change sensor for Han EV
- Firstly, before installing the BYD Han EV lane change sensor (OE# 1331109800), make sure the mounting area is clean and free of debris. This helps ensure a stable installation.
- Secondly, carefully align the sensor with the designated position on the vehicle body. Incorrect alignment can lead to inaccurate sensor readings.
- Thirdly, check the wiring connections thoroughly. Ensure all wires are properly plugged in and secured to prevent signal loss.
- Then, calibrate the lane change sensor after installation. This step is crucial for the sensor to function correctly and detect lane changes accurately.
- Finally, test the sensor in a safe environment. Check if it can effectively detect adjacent lanes and provide timely alerts.
Warning: Do not touch the sensor surface with bare hands during installation. Oils from your hands can affect the sensor's performance. Wear gloves to avoid contamination.
